This furniture expert’s decor advice will help bring any room together

BY Olena Kysla

Senior General Manager at Western Furniture Gayatri Dongre shares some décor tips and tricks of how to spruce up a space with confidence

1. Colours 

Jotun

Go big or go home in the simplest ways possible. Minimalism still rules. To make the space more enticing, it is advisable to use cool shade colours instead of dark coloured tints. Choose colours that rouse your personality and make you content. Layer them in various tones throughout the space. This will embrace depth and intrigue even in a monochromatic room.

2. Lighting

Once the room is lit the correct way, it creates an inviting environment and encourages people to loosen up and feel comfortable. The correct lampshade can make or break a room. You should invest in a combination of floor lamps, table lamps, chandeliers and dimmers depending on the function of the room.

3. Comfort 

Flexform

When it comes to choosing furniture or flooring, your top priority should be comfort. If it feels great to sit or to put your feet on then they will be beneficial investments for your home. In the long run, it doesn’t make a difference whether the pieces are conventional, customary or modern as long as it reflects your personality. Once you’ve discovered the right mix of accessories that work for you, place them with confidence!

4. Greenery

Make sure to infuse greenery to add a peaceful and calming vibe to your haven. Rich greenery relaxes corners and traps the eye into speculation there is something more to the room than there genuinely is.

5. Storage 

Give your storage solutions a chance to pull double duty. Smart finds will help you maximize your home’s storage capabilities while adding cool and vintage elements to any room decor.  For example, ottomans can be utilized as a comforting element to the room and also as a hidden storage component.
